Description
Summary:Samples of a series of fluorine-containing copolymers have been studied by pyrolytic gas chromatography. In the volatile products of pyrolysis of polymers containing ethylene and hexafluoropropylene units at least three “hybrid” fluorine-containing compounds are present-vinylidene fluoride, tetrafluoropropylene and 1-trifluoro-methyl-1,2,2,-triflurocyclobutane. The basic scheme of rupture of the main C - C bonds on pyrolysis of these polymers is proposed. The optically transparent terpolymer of tetrafluoroethylene, ethylene and hexafluoropropylene constitutes a regularly alternating terpolymer in which the perfluorinated tetrafluoroethylene or hexafluoropropylene units are between the ethylene units.
